I don’t do the cooking but I know how to heat stuff up. Just get yourself a rice cooker. It is small, light weight (3.7 Lb) and needs very little power (350 watts). It is great for boondocking. Now I have never cooked rice in it but have heated up lots of food from soup to any leftovers. It is also very inexpensive- $20. If you want to save another 30% get a used one, probably just the box is slightly damaged.

It will vary depending on the many options you select. Base price is around $19k for a Grand Lounge plus extra if you spec various finishes or table tops. That includes the lounge, new dual dinettes, upgraded cushions and materials, lower cabinets, and the side desk/cabinet next to the fridge. That’s a lot for sure but they have the trailer for about six weeks. Thinking hard on having them also redo the hanging closets with matching drawers. Things that add more cost to a bid are countertop finishes or appliance add ons. They are booked out for quite a while.

I’m lucky to have gotten my 27FB International before the significant cost increases during Covid. This upgrade will make the trailer more functional for ann overall investment still less than a current AS and avoid any need to upgrade to a new trailer.

6 stage reverse osmosis water system

from iSping / 123filters.com

i had to move parts around so that it would fit under the sink
no loss in storage as all elements are under the sink and near the rear

the pressurized water storage tank goes in next. the OEM told me that it can be used in any position Vert or Horizontal
